About the role
- Support US Places Design & Engineering business area in Dallas, Texas area
- Work directly with Fire Protection Engineers, Mechanical and/or Electrical Engineers, Architects, and clients
- Lead fire protection discipline of multiple and concurrent projects through pursuit, proposal, design, and construction phases
- Travel to project sites (approx. 1 week a month) for surveys, data collection, and collaboration with client team members
Requirements
- Bachelor of Science (BS) in mechanical or fire protection engineering with proven experience in a similar role
- Fire Protection Professional Engineering Licensure in the United States* *is essential* *
- Extensive experience producing IFC design packages for federal agency facilities
- Deep knowledge of life safety codes
- Knowledge of industry standards, building codes, and safety standards such as NFPA, NEC, NESC, UL, etc.
- An advanced technical understanding of fire alarm and suppression systems, smoke control, and other related equipment and technologies
- Strong communication skills related to presentations, project communications, and written documents
